Opened 12 years ago

Closed 12 years ago

Last modified 11 years ago

#15723 closed update (fixed)

p5-parse-recdescent-1.95.1 New version and workaround for version numbering

Reported by: stolen-from-macports-trac@… Owned by: macports-tickets@…
Priority: Normal Milestone:
Component: ports Version: 1.6.0
Keywords: perl cpan Cc:
Port:

Description

Current version of Parse::RecDescent on CPAN is 1.95.1. For some reason it's been posted as version "v1.95.1" (the "v" as part of the version in the filename).

This portfile incorporates the following changes:

  • Updated version and new checksums for it.
  • New dependency on p5-text-balanced (I don't know whether that's new to this version or it was just overlooked).
  • Several contortions to accommodate that extra v:
    • New distname format defined.
    • New master_sites URL points directly at the module's home on CPAN (apparently the mirroring process doesn't like that v, either?).
    • New livecheck.regex accounts for the v (but will still work without it).

Attachments (2)

p5-parse-recdescent-1.95-1.diff.2.txt (3.8 KB) - added by stolen-from-macports-trac@… 12 years ago.
p5-parse-recdescent-1.95-1.diff.txt (1.6 KB) - added by stolen-from-macports-trac@… 12 years ago.

Download all attachments as: .zip

Change History (8)

Changed 12 years ago by stolen-from-macports-trac@…

comment:1 Changed 12 years ago by stolen-from-macports-trac@…

Here's an updated patch. I overlooked a lib dependency on p5-version and a build dependency on p5-test-simple (Test::More).

Sorry about the double upload.

comment:2 Changed 12 years ago by jmroot (Joshua Root)

Could you please separate the functional changes from the cosmetic ones?

Changed 12 years ago by stolen-from-macports-trac@…

comment:3 in reply to:  2 Changed 12 years ago by stolen-from-macports-trac@…

No problem; I have reduced it to functional changes only and re-uploaded it (p5-parse-recdescent-1.95-1.diff.txt).

comment:4 Changed 12 years ago by raimue (Rainer Müller)

Resolution: fixed
Status: newclosed

Updated to 1.96.0 in r40924.

comment:5 Changed 11 years ago by jmroot (Joshua Root)

Type: enhancementupdate

comment:6 Changed 11 years ago by (none)

Milestone: Port Updates

Milestone Port Updates deleted

Note: See TracTickets for help on using tickets.